Tools and Supplies Needed

In addition to the bunk bed kit, you will need several standard tools and supplies to ensure a successful assembly. Common tools include a Phillips or flat-head screwdriver, a drill (if bolts are provided), and a pencil. Additionally, you may need socket wrenches or pliers if your bed uses these tools. Make sure you have all the necessary supplies before you begin, as it is better to be prepared than to interrupt the process to fetch them.

Step-by-Step Assembly Process

Step 1: Unboxing and Inventory Check

Begin by unboxing the bunk bed kit and laying out all the parts to ensure you have all the components. Carefully check that all the nuts, bolts, screws, and bed components are present. If anything is missing, contact the manufacturer. This initial step is crucial to avoid any frustration later on during the assembly process.

Step 2: Assembly of the Bed Frame

The base of the bunk bed, or the bottom bed, should be assembled first. If the bed frame is divided into sections with posts and railings, start by attaching the posts to the slats. Use the provided hardware to secure the posts and slats together. Take your time and ensure that the posts are set perpendicular and the slats are level to provide stability and ensure safety.

Final Touches and Safety Checks

Before using your new bunk bed, take a moment to check all the connections and ensure that everything is tightly secured. Test the bed to ensure that it is level and stable. Make sure that there are no loose screws or bolts, and that all components are properly fastened. A small mishap can be avoided by double-checking every step to ensure that the bed is safe and comfortable to use.

Using a large enough mattress is also essential. Ensure that the mattress you choose has enough dimensions for the size of the bed. A mismatched mattress might not fit snugly or might slide and cause accidents. Always choose a mattress that is the right size for your bunk bed to ensure a secure fit.
